It is something I am passionate about and therefore was delighted the chief executive of Morrisons, Rami Baitiéh, announced a dedicated section on morrisons.com where shoppers can find all British produce available to them.

I, along with other parliamentary colleagues, have been campaigning for this and wrote to all supermarket bosses in the summer urging them to act.

Online grocery shopping is becoming increasingly popular but labelling can be difficult to see online compared to in a store and so we wanted to ensure everyone wanting to buy British could do and this was as easy as possible.

Not only does it end the hassle for shoppers having to search through different items and supports farmers, but buying British creates more jobs and will also create new careers for future generations with creative minds to deliver global solutions for new British industries.

The strength of support for this idea is clear. Since we started campaigning for clearer labelling, more than 27,000 people have signed a petition started by the National Farmer’s Union supporting the Buy British Button.

I know from speaking to my farmers across Tatton how important this issue is and it is something they want to see implemented across all platforms.

I hope other supermarkets will follow the lead of Morrisons and make this simple change to their website.

It will go some way to showing our continued support for our farmers, who work so hard to ensure our food security, and will help celebrate the great produce we produce in this country.
